Output 17a665a9806137a0894d1a385ee7004cb72ce432000de03d01ffec300a69aae3:13

value
10324784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c8b454f26254e72b741313b2941d3397fced2a OP_EQUAL
address
M94kmvJW8TyNNpfgbP5pmpovDGo5TW1cEr
transaction
17a665a9806137a0894d1a385ee7004cb72ce432000de03d01ffec300a69aae3
spent
true